Overview

The July 2012 issue of NASA Tech Briefs and Photonics Tech Briefs presents a comprehensive overview of advancements in engineering and technology, particularly focusing on MEMS (Micro-Electro-Mechanical Systems), innovations in IndyCar racing, and emergency communication solutions. This edition serves as a valuable resource for engineers and professionals in the field, showcasing the latest developments and applications of photonics technology.

Key Highlights:

  1. MEMS-Based Systems Solutions: The issue opens with a discussion on MEMS technology, which has become increasingly vital in various applications, including automotive, aerospace, and consumer electronics. MEMS devices are known for their small size, low power consumption, and high performance, making them ideal for applications that require precision and reliability. The article emphasizes the role of MEMS in enhancing system performance and enabling new functionalities in modern devices.

  2. The Engineering of IndyCar Racing: A feature article delves into the engineering challenges and innovations in IndyCar racing. The sport demands high-performance vehicles that can withstand extreme conditions while ensuring driver safety. The article highlights the integration of advanced materials, aerodynamics, and telemetry systems that contribute to the overall performance of the cars. It also discusses how engineering advancements in racing can translate to improvements in commercial automotive technologies.

  3. NASA Spinoff Supports Emergency Communications: This section focuses on technologies developed by NASA that have been adapted for use in emergency communication systems. The article outlines how innovations originally designed for space exploration are now being utilized to enhance communication capabilities during disasters. These technologies improve the reliability and speed of communication, which is crucial in emergency response situations.

  4. Photonics Solutions for the Design Engineer: The issue features a range of articles dedicated to photonics technology, which plays a critical role in various engineering applications. Topics include:

    • Ensuring Safe Operation and Accurate Characterization of Laser Diodes: This article discusses the importance of safe handling and accurate measurement of laser diodes. It introduces the 6100 Combo Laser Diode Driver and Temperature Controller by Newport Corporation, designed to ensure reliable operation and characterization of laser diodes.
    • Comparing Apples to Oranges – Self-Service Scales With USB Cameras: This piece explores the integration of USB cameras with self-service scales, enhancing the functionality and user experience in retail environments.
    • Laser Systems: The issue presents a detailed overview of a 885-nm pumped ceramic Nd:YAG master oscillator power amplifier laser system, highlighting its applications and benefits in various fields.
    • Terahertz Quantum Cascade Laser: An article discusses the development of a terahertz quantum cascade laser with efficient coupling and beam profile, showcasing its potential applications in imaging and spectroscopy.
    • Measurement Techniques: The issue also covers advanced measurement techniques such as optical near-nulling and subaperture stitching, which are essential for high-precision optical measurements.
  5. Product of the Month/New Products: The magazine includes a section dedicated to new products and innovations in the field of photonics and engineering. This section provides readers with insights into the latest tools and technologies available in the market, helping them stay updated on advancements that can enhance their work.
